August 22 is Black Women's Equal Pay Day, which marks how far Black women had to work into 2019 to make what white men earned in 2018 alone. For a second year, LeanIn.Org and SurveyMonkey have partnered to conduct new research to measure Americans' awareness of this pay gap and better understand the experiences of Black women in the workplace. The results are clear and troubling: Black women face far more barriers to advancement, and only half of Americans think these obstacles still exist.
